Output 84362863134568b52161a89096d049bfa4ddc72496c6f8c106c6bc527fb220fb:0

value
7420814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91ad8074cbd4514b2edb63e812bca05c7bd48af OP_EQUAL
address
3H7AH7B9f5AjpPUgmqSyfSQQJWdWrtqEH5
transaction
84362863134568b52161a89096d049bfa4ddc72496c6f8c106c6bc527fb220fb
spent
true